Reintegrate branch: 20130111-hock-message_classes
improvements:
- new message classes (reboost, zero-copy)
- "fast path" for direct links (skip overlay layer)
- link-properties accessible from the application
- SystemQueue can call boost::bind functions
- protlib compatibility removed (32bit overhead saved in every message)
- addressing2
- AddressDiscovery discoveres only addresses on which we're actually listening
- ariba serialization usage reduced (sill used in OverlayMsg)
- Node::connect, easier and cleaner interface to start-up ariba from the application
- ariba configs via JSON, XML, etc (boost::property_tree)
- keep-alive overhead greatly reduced
- (relayed) overlay links can actually be closed now
- lost messages are detected in most cases
- notification to the application when link is transformed into direct-link
- overlay routing: send message to second best hop if it would be dropped otherwise
- SequenceNumbers (only mechanisms, so for: upward compatibility)
- various small fixes
regressions:
- bluetooth is not yet working again
- bootstrap modules deactivated
- liblog4xx is not working (use cout-logging)
This patch brings great performance and stability improvements at cost of backward compatibility.
Also bluetooth and the bootstrap modules have not been ported to the new interfaces, yet.
